Crossdomain xml silverlight for mac

Apr 15, 2008 in silverlight 2, the primary way of enabling cross domain calls is through a policy file placed at the root of the server. A builtin silverlight tool part is also part of sharepoint foundation 2010. Because there is not any interaction between the stream and the player, the security provided by the crossdomain. If the silverlight application accesses sharepoint foundation data and is hosted on a server outside the domain of the web application, you create external application xml that users, in turn, use to register the hosting silverlight web part. In order for silverlight to call a remote resource on a different domain from where the xap file was served such as a web service,the domain where the service must grant access to the silverlight application. First, we are going to create a web service using visual studio. Silverlight supports a subset of flashs crossdomain. Im working on a silverlight app hosted on iis 6 windows server 2003, which talks to a web service on a jboss app server jboss 4. Silverlight cross domain policy file clientaccesspolicy. Visualiza contenidos web elaborados mediante esta tecnologia. To do this a service has to provide a clientaccesspolicy. To access data from a different server other than the one hosting your flex application, the remote server needs to have a crossdomain file in the root directory. Is there any other way that i can work on to get resolved this issue.

When working with adobe flex, the client access policy file is named crossdomain. He also provides steps to take in order to prevent attacks and operation of crossdomain client access policy with the help of relevant screenshots and. Dec 12, 2008 test in fiddler, firebug, or the ie web developer toolbar to watch network traffic and verify your silverlight app is trying to connect to the right url for crossdomain. This indicates that you do not have a clientaccesspolicy. As a result, permissions are granted to flash to access the services on the remote server. Since domain boundaries are crossed in these scenarios the silverlight clientaccesspolicy. Silverlight supports crossdomain socket communications between a. If this file doesnt exists it will look for the crossdomain. See the faq topic in this help system for more details.

I am building an app prototype using the avs with silverlight, but unfortunately this plugin uses its own method to validate crossdomain requests by looking for a crossdomain. Silverlight has a buildin security step that requests the clientaccesspolicy. Cross domain access policy in silverlight applications. Every time i go to download it from the microsoft website, it just tells me error, cant access page etc. You should use crossdomain policy files when accessing third party web services. May 15, 2012 silverlight has a buildin security step that requests the clientaccesspolicy.

So this is the answer use both files if you want flash support for your webservice, but apply specific restrictions into clientaccesspolicy. A simple page that accepts any url to a silverlight app or page, decomposes the uri parts, and checks for either of the accepted crossdomain policy files on the site. To enable the sharing of information between domains with flash or silverlight, developers can make use of a crossdomain. When a silverlight application makes a crossdomain call other than those that are allowed by default, it first fetches a file called clientaccesspolicy. For a critical web application like a banking application, it is mandatory to configure the crossdomain. It does matter where you place the policy file it needs to be placed at the root of the web server thats running your service. By using a proxy its possible to get access to any publicly available data regardless of the existence of cross domain policy files. Actually at the access to a resource from other domain, silverlight runtime checks if clientaccesspolicy. A crossdomain policy file is an xml document that grants a web client, such as adobe flash. Do a search for php flash proxy to see what i mean. After the download is completed, installation should start automatically. Personally, i think its a really dumb convention, but its out there. These policies will be the same for iis 5 and iis 7. This could be due to attempting to access a service in a crossdomain way without a proper crossdomain policy in place, or a policy that is unsuitable for soap services.

Ill cover the following topics in the code samples below. It exposes the domain hosting the improperly configured crossomain. A crossdomain policy file is an xml document that grants a web clientsuch as adobe flash player, adobe reader, etc. Both files exist on the host of the silverlight portal. I could host a xap on a bogey server and no bells would go off accessing the wcfportal. If this file is found, parameters of the access to this domain are set in it. Net framework and compatible with multiple browsers, devices and operating systems, bringing a new level of interactivity.

Create external application xml markup, and the other topics under the web parts that host external applications such as silverlight node of this sdk. Flash player has included native support for xml parsing and. Silverlight is a powerful development platform for creating engaging, interactive user experiences for web, desktop, and mobile applications when online or offline. Each xml message is a complete xml document, terminated by a zero byte.

Using fiddler to trick silverlight into allowing a. For more information, see silverlightwebpart, silverlighttoolpart, how to. Deploying wcf and silverlight applications on iis 5 and 7. In silverlight 2, the primary way of enabling cross domain calls is through a policy file placed at the root of the server. Obviously, for better or worse, silverlight has been trained to know that any image that doesnt come from the same domain it was served from is. Silverlight supports two different mechanisms for services to optin to cross domain access. He also claimed that when one of apples macintosh computers crashes. In this crossdomain call the silverlight first looks for the clientaccesspolicy. Jul 07, 2016 i cant download silverlight on my mac.

In this post, well see how to enable full access to blob storage through silverlight. Download and install the latest version microsoft silverlight plug in for your browser. Arcgis viewer for silverlight frequently asked questions. Solved cross domain issue in silverlight with wcf codeproject. Then ill click on the line, and a box pops up saying the version of silverlight found on the computer does not contain the latest security updates. Access a web service from a silverlight application. In this article, sergey examines the role of cross domain access policy in silverlight. For more information on the structure and function of a clientaccesspolicy.

T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. Locate the install silverlight area in the lowerright part of the window. Extendedimage loading external url image not working at all. You did not specify whether the wcf service is hosted as a service, selfhosted, or hosted in iis. However, there are so many great legitimate uses for crossdomain access like creating clientside mashups that several technologies have been developed to allow it under limited, optin circumstances. Sep 15, 2012 to enable a silverlight control to access a service in another domain, the service must explicitly optin to allow crossdomain access. Apr 16, 2018 locate the install silverlight area in the lowerright part of the window. Cant download silverlight on my mac microsoft community. Cross domain configuration acrobat application security guide. Silverlight and crossdomain access to media and services.

Note, arcgis online already hosts both files to support cross domain access for all silverlight clients. Below you can find more details about the usage of these files. Build a very simple test silverlight app which does nothing but make the crossdomain call. When working with microsoft silverlight, the file is typically clientaccesspolicy. My best advice on these issues is to run the fiddler tool and trace the traffic and you should see silverlight looking for a clientaccesspolicy. Here you can see the silverlights cross domain policy flow.

Silverlight web service error crossdomain policy codeproject. For security reasons, the web browser cannot access data that resides outside the exact domain where the shockwave flash swf. By default, arcgis server allows crossdomain requests. This file informs the browser that it should allow. If youre exposing your own services to silverlight, youll want to look at. Jon galloway silverlight crossdomain access workarounds. Silverlight, when asked to do a crossdomain call, will look for this file at the root of the domain where the target service is hosted. Sep 04, 2016 first, a little line pops up saying silverlight is outdated. By optingin, a service states that the operations it exposes can safely be invoked by a silverlight control, without potentially damaging consequences to the data that the service stores. Otherwise, click runtime for mac powerpc next to silverlight 1. Attackers cannot only forge requests, they can read responses. Silverlight and crossdomain access to media and services, the truth i thought i knew everything about silverlight and cross domain and cross schema. When calling a crossdomain service, silverlight will check for the existence of clientaccesspolicy. You can help protect yourself from scammers by verifying that the contact is a microsoft agent or microsoft employee and that the phone number is an official microsoft global customer service number.

In most cases, just place the xml file at the root of your web site e. If you are running an intel processor, click mac runtime next to silverlight 3. Now that weve got the background information out of the way we can get on to the interesting stuff. Jul 02, 2015 silverlight 5 introduces more than 40 new features, including dramatic video quality and performance improvements as well as features that improve developer productivity. Silverlight for mac is not being recognized or you are. Significance and best practices of the clientaccesspolicy. Adobe flash player is computer software for using content created on the adobe flash platform.

Photobucket already host a cross domain policy that permits flash content to. Whenever you are uploading a file to a different domain you will get the crossdomain issue. Obviously, for better or worse, silverlight has been trained to know that any image that doesnt come from the same domain it was served from is a baddie, unless there is an enabling policy file there. Oh and heres the official documentation for flash crossdomain. If you need to use the silverlight client, you need to add two more files to the virtual directory. Microsoft silverlight for for mac free downloads and. Cross domain access from silverlight microsoft dynamics 365. Silverlight supports two different mechanisms for services to optin to crossdomain access. After a short introduction, he examines the interaction between client and server as well as a list of threats which may occur in rich internet applications.

1560 472 356 1374 366 1016 1569 470 1107 999 486 387 1088 1432 1387 1089 1243 874 1273 579 975 1049 893 456 406 1418 1034 719 401 1442 1024 939 1020 1397 903 1328 91 172 124 866 758 1320 663 779